Now I can report: Today I had an appointment at Hipica Gillilo in San Miguel de las Salinas, and it was really great. We’ve been out for 2 hours with 4 riders, Jesus ( the owner), me and another couple, we did some trot and some canter (one very fast). The surrounding was nice, through the orange trees towards some hills.

My horse was in a good state, easy to handle but also moved willingly. 

For the two hours I paid 35€. On Saturday I’ll do another hack there for 4 hours. 

I can absolutely recommend. The only thing which might be a little difficult if you do not speak Spanish, Jesus (the owner) doesn’t speak any English. But his wife is Swedish, so maybe she could translate.
